As per this report, the North America automotive steering system market is anticipated to develop with a CAGR of 4.19% by revenue, during the forecast period between 2021 and 2028. The United States and Canada together form the market in this region.

In 2018, the United States exported 1.8 million light vehicles and 131,200 medium & heavy trucks to over 200 markets worldwide, with additional exports of auto parts. With a huge consumer market, well-equipped infrastructure, favorable investment policies, a highly skilled workforce, and favorable government incentives, the United States has become a premier market for the 21st-century automotive industry. This will influence the demand for steering systems in the coming years.

Also, according to Nexteer Automotive, a leading automobile steering manufacturing company in North America, R-EPS captures over 90% of the full-size truck market in the region. A high demand for powerful light commercial vehicles in the United States is thus expected to further propel the growth of the R-EPS segment here.

In addition, Canada is one of the leading producers of light vehicles across the world. Five global original equipment manufacturers, Toyota, Honda, Stellantis, GM, and Ford, assemble over 1.4 million vehicles at their Canadian plants each year. This indicates a positive outlook for the Canadian automotive market, which, in turn, will aid the demand for automotive steering systems in the country in the coming period.

The dominant players in the automotive steering system market are Mitsubishi Electric Corporation, Denso Corporation, JTEKT Corporation, Robert Bosch GmbH, Honda Motor Company, and Nexteer Automotive Corporation.
